About Terry L. Clark

Terry L. Clark is a scholar working on Earth-Surface Processes, Atmospheric Science and Global and Planetary Change, having authored 88 papers that have together received 4.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ations (40 papers), Atmospheric aerosols and clouds (24 papers) and Aeolian processes and effects (22 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atmospheric Science (3.5k citations), Global and Planetary Change (2.8k citations) and Earth-Surface Processes (560 citations). Terry L. Clark has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and Australia. Frequent co-authors include W. R. Peltier, William D. Hall, Piotr K. Smolarkiewicz, Richard D. Farley, Todd P. Lane, Joachim P. Kuettner, Janice L. Coen, Wojciech W. Grabowski, T. Hauf and Michael J. Reeder.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res, Journal of Computational Physics and Journal of the Atmospheric Sciences.
